    Abstract: The invention is directed to a method for determining causes of faults in the formation of the air/fuel mixture for an internal combustion engine. First, different operating parameters of the engine are detected and at least three load signals are formed on the basis of at least somewhat different operating parameters. The three load signals represent respective air quantities which flow into the engine. Different pairs of two load signals in each pair are formed and deviations of the each two load signals of a pair with respect to each other are determined for different pairs. Different causes are allocated to different combinations of pairs wherein deviations were determined.

    Abstract: The invention is directed to a method for determining the actual torque (M_act) developed by an internal combustion engine by evaluating the trace of the rpm (n) of the crankshaft of the engine. The method is simple, operates rapidly and requires especially little computation power. An index (A) for the actual torque (M_act) can be determined from the rpm (n) in different ways. The actual torque (M_act), which is developed by the engine, is determined from the index (A). The index (A) can be determined in a work stroke of a cylinder of the engine from: (a) the difference of the areas (F1, F2) between the trace of the rpm (n) and the mean rpm (n_) or from the ratio of the areas (F1, F2); (b) the difference or the ratio of the extremes (E1, E2) of the maximum or minimum rpms (n) to each other; and (c) the difference or the ratio of the extremes (E1, E2) and the mean rpm (n_).

    Abstract: A method and an arrangement for operating internal combustion engines is suggested which is operated in at least one operating state with a lean air/fuel mixture. The fuel mass, which is to be injected, or the injection time, which is to be outputted, is determined in dependence upon a desired value. For monitoring the operability, the actual torque of the engine is determined on the basis of the fuel mass, which is to be injected, or the injection time, which is to be outputted, or the outputted injection time and compared to a maximum permissible torque and a fault reaction is initiated when the actual torque exceeds the maximum permissible torque. Parallel to the above, a quantity, which represents the oxygen concentration in the exhaust gas, is compared to at least one pregiven limit value and a fault reaction is initiated when this quantity exceeds the limit value.
